firefox 0.8 (former firebird) and thunderbird 0.5 I would like to hear about successes as well as failures. /Peter
Index: Makefile
===================================================================
RCS file: /cvs/ports/mail/mozilla-thunderbird/Makefile,v
retrieving revision 1.2
diff -u -r1.2 Makefile
--- Makefile 19 Jan 2004 14:36:49 -0000 1.2
+++ Makefile 9 Feb 2004 14:55:14 -0000
@@ -4,7 +4,7 @@
COMMENT= "redesign of the integrated Mozilla App-Suite mail component"
-VER= 0.4
+VER= 0.5
DISTNAME= mozilla
PKGNAME= mozilla-thunderbird-${VER}
@@ -18,8 +18,9 @@
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yes
-MASTER_SITES= http://ftp.mozilla.org/pub/thunderbird/releases/${VER}/
-DISTFILES= thunderbird-source-${VER}.tar.bz2
+MASTER_SITES= http://ftp.eu.mozilla.org/pub/mozilla.org/thunderbird/releases/${VER}/ \
+ http://ftp.mozilla.org/pub/thunderbird/releases/${VER}/
+DISTFILES= thunderbird-${VER}-source.tar.bz2
MODULES= gcc3
MODGCC3_ARCHES= alpha sparc64 powerpc
@@ -41,15 +42,20 @@
NO_REGRESS= Yes
CONFIGURE_STYLE= autoconf
-CONFIGURE_ARGS= \
- --with-system-jpeg=${LOCALBASE} \
+CONFIGURE_ARGS= --with-system-jpeg=${LOCALBASE} \
--with-system-mng=${LOCALBASE} \
--with-system-png=${LOCALBASE} \
--with-system-zlib=/usr/lib \
--with-pthreads \
--enable-xft \
- --enable-optimize=-O2 \
- --disable-mathml \
+ --enable-optimize=-Os \
+ --disable-debug \
+ --disable-tests \
+ --disable-pedantic \
+ --disable-installer
+
+#
+CONFIGURE_ARGS+=--disable-mathml \
--disable-installer \
--disable-activex \
--disable-activex-scripting \
@@ -60,9 +66,6 @@
--enable-necko-protocols=http,file,jar,viewsource,res,data \
--enable-image-decoders=png,gif,jpeg,bmp \
--enable-crypto \
- --disable-pedantic \
- --disable-debug \
- --disable-tests \
--disable-ldap
CFLAGS+= -fno-stack-protector
@@ -75,6 +78,8 @@
MOZ= ${PREFIX}/mozilla-thunderbird
post-extract:
+ # Hopefully an distfile without dos-text files will come soon
+ cd ${WRKSRC} && find . -type f -print0 | xargs -0 perl -pi -e 's/\r\n/\n/'
@cp ${FILESDIR}/xptc* ${WRKSRC}/xpcom/reflect/xptcall/src/md/unix/
pre-configure:
@@ -83,7 +88,7 @@
${WRKSRC}/mail/app/mozilla.in
do-install:
-.for dir in chrome components defaults icons plugins res
+.for dir in chrome components defaults plugins res
${INSTALL_DATA_DIR} ${MOZ}/${dir}
@cd ${MOB}/bin && ${TAR} -chf - ${dir} | \
${TAR} -xf - -C ${MOZ}
Index: distinfo
===================================================================
RCS file: /cvs/ports/mail/mozilla-thunderbird/distinfo,v
retrieving revision 1.1.1.1
diff -u -r1.1.1.1 distinfo
--- distinfo 18 Jan 2004 11:47:42 -0000 1.1.1.1
+++ distinfo 9 Feb 2004 10:26:23 -0000
@@ -1,3 +1,3 @@
-MD5 (thunderbird-source-0.4.tar.bz2) = 2de7805fcb3ca4a08b6062b426dfdad3
-RMD160 (thunderbird-source-0.4.tar.bz2) = ac39b85173c9882ffc535140bd07f709fa2dcf98
-SHA1 (thunderbird-source-0.4.tar.bz2) = e84fab22248c8052e110272204214ff3a3ad0690
+MD5 (thunderbird-0.5-source.tar.bz2) = 2abfab98dcd7373325bcc9aac411f881
+RMD160 (thunderbird-0.5-source.tar.bz2) = 09f0ebc3467aaa980ab857078d6096935497e264
+SHA1 (thunderbird-0.5-source.tar.bz2) = 634b0fe6f8c1344be74460f3da296bdeffb5c7dc
Index: pkg/PFRAG.shared
===================================================================
RCS file: /cvs/ports/mail/mozilla-thunderbird/pkg/PFRAG.shared,v
retrieving revision 1.1.1.1
diff -u -r1.1.1.1 PFRAG.shared
--- pkg/PFRAG.shared 18 Jan 2004 11:48:09 -0000 1.1.1.1
+++ pkg/PFRAG.shared 9 Feb 2004 14:56:33 -0000
@@ -12,7 +12,6 @@
mozilla-thunderbird/components/libgfxps.so.1.0
mozilla-thunderbird/components/libgfxxprint.so.1.0
mozilla-thunderbird/components/libgklayout.so.1.0
-mozilla-thunderbird/components/libgkplugin.so.1.0
mozilla-thunderbird/components/libhtmlpars.so.1.0
mozilla-thunderbird/components/libi18n.so.1.0
mozilla-thunderbird/components/libimglib2.so.1.0
@@ -65,7 +64,5 @@
mozilla-thunderbird/libxpcom.so.1.0
mozilla-thunderbird/libxpcom_compat.so.1.0
mozilla-thunderbird/libxpistub.so.1.0
-mozilla-thunderbird/plugins/libnullplugin.so.1.0
@comment NEWDYNLIBDIR(%D/mozilla-thunderbird)
@comment NEWDYNLIBDIR(%D/mozilla-thunderbird/components)
-_(_at_)_comment NEWDYNLIBDIR(%D/mozilla-thunderbird/plugins)
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/mail/mozilla-thunderbird/pkg/PLIST,v
retrieving revision 1.1.1.1
diff -u -r1.1.1.1 PLIST
--- pkg/PLIST 18 Jan 2004 11:48:09 -0000 1.1.1.1
+++ pkg/PLIST 9 Feb 2004 14:56:10 -0000
@@ -193,8 +193,6 @@
mozilla-thunderbird/defaults/wallet/SchemaStrings.tbl
mozilla-thunderbird/defaults/wallet/StateSchema.tbl
mozilla-thunderbird/defaults/wallet/VcardSchema.tbl
-mozilla-thunderbird/icons/mozicon16.xpm
-mozilla-thunderbird/icons/mozicon50.xpm
mozilla-thunderbird/regchrome
mozilla-thunderbird/regxpcom
mozilla-thunderbird/res/EditorOverride.css
@@ -362,9 +360,9 @@
mozilla-thunderbird/run-mozilla.sh
mozilla-thunderbird/thunderbird-bin
%%SHARED%%
-_(_at_)_comment @exec mkdir -p %D/share/pixmaps
+_(_at_)_exec mkdir -p %D/share/pixmaps
@comment @dirrm share/pixmaps
-_(_at_)_comment @exec mkdir -p %D/share/applications
+_(_at_)_exec mkdir -p %D/share/applications
@comment @dirrm share/applications
@dirrm mozilla-thunderbird/res/throbber
@dirrm mozilla-thunderbird/res/samples/sampleimages
@@ -376,8 +374,8 @@
@dirrm mozilla-thunderbird/res/dtd
@dirrm mozilla-thunderbird/res/builtin
@dirrm mozilla-thunderbird/res
+_(_at_)_exec mkdir -p %D/mozilla-thunderbird/plugins
@dirrm mozilla-thunderbird/plugins
-_(_at_)_dirrm mozilla-thunderbird/icons
@dirrm mozilla-thunderbird/defaults/wallet
@dirrm mozilla-thunderbird/defaults/profile/chrome
@dirrm mozilla-thunderbird/defaults/profile/US/chrome
@@ -391,6 +389,8 @@
@dirrm mozilla-thunderbird/defaults
@dirrm mozilla-thunderbird/components/myspell
@dirrm mozilla-thunderbird/components
+_(_at_)_exec mkdir -p %D/mozilla-thunderbird/chrome/toolkit/content/mozapps/xpinstall
+_(_at_)_dirrm mozilla-thunderbird/chrome/toolkit/content/mozapps/xpinstall
@exec mkdir -p %D/mozilla-thunderbird/chrome/toolkit/content/mozapps/downloads
@dirrm mozilla-thunderbird/chrome/toolkit/content/mozapps/downloads
@dirrm mozilla-thunderbird/chrome/toolkit/content/mozapps
@@ -475,6 +475,8 @@
@dirrm mozilla-thunderbird/chrome/en-US/locale/en-US/necko
@exec mkdir -p %D/mozilla-thunderbird/chrome/en-US/locale/en-US/navigator
@dirrm mozilla-thunderbird/chrome/en-US/locale/en-US/navigator
+_(_at_)_exec mkdir -p %D/mozilla-thunderbird/chrome/en-US/locale/en-US/mozapps/xpinstall
+_(_at_)_dirrm mozilla-thunderbird/chrome/en-US/locale/en-US/mozapps/xpinstall
@exec mkdir -p %D/mozilla-thunderbird/chrome/en-US/locale/en-US/mozapps/downloads
@dirrm mozilla-thunderbird/chrome/en-US/locale/en-US/mozapps/downloads
@dirrm mozilla-thunderbird/chrome/en-US/locale/en-US/mozapps
@@ -588,6 +590,8 @@
@ex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/navigator/btn1
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/navigator/btn1
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/navigator
+_(_at_)_ex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/mozapps/xpinstall
+_(_at_)_dirrm mozilla-thunderbird/chrome/classic/skin/classic/mozapps/xpinstall
@ex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/mozapps/pref
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/mozapps/pref
@ex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/mozapps/downloads
@@ -610,8 +614,7 @@
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/global/toolbar
@ex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/global/splitter
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/global/splitter
-_(_at_)_ex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/global/scrollbar/slider
-_(_at_)_dirrm mozilla-thunderbird/chrome/classic/skin/classic/global/scrollbar/slider
+_(_at_)_ex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/global/scrollbar
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/global/scrollbar
@exec mkdir -p %D/mozilla-thunderbird/chrome/classic/skin/classic/global/radio
@dirrm mozilla-thunderbird/chrome/classic/skin/classic/global/radio
Attachment:
mozilla-firefox-0.8.tgz
Description: application/tar-gz